Why would he sign that when he knows he can sign his QO for more?
If he doesn't perform at a value close to $6 million this season, he may well not be offered the QO next year...become a free agent, and end up signing elsewhere for a lot less than $6million/yr. If he agrees to $4million/yr for a 3 year extension, he'd be getting $18 million over the next 4 years (average of $4.5/yr) without the risk of having a bad year this year.

Or, I wouldn't be surprised if Carolina has already come to a longer trem extension deal with KK, assuming Habs don't match.
